Generalisations of Rozansky-Witten invariants
Abstract
We survey briefly the definition of the Rozansky-Witten invariants, and review their relevance to the study of compact hyperkahler manifolds. We consider how various generalisations of the invariants might prove useful for the study of non-compact hyperkahler manifolds, of quaternionic-Kahler manifolds, and of relations between hyperkahler manifolds and Lie algebras. The paper concludes with a list of additional problems.
